I'm going to have to disagree on the last part. There are definitely some nice shoes that did retro without any hype. For example, the AM Plus/TN in hyper blue cw. If there was hype around this shoe (USA) they would have been wiped off of shelves immediately a couple years back. They sat for a couple months in Champs. Mind you this is an OG cw of the 1998 release (there might have been small differences). Same goes for the Orange/Sunrise cw that is sort of similar to the Tigers.

92 tailwainds, persian/jade BW's, laser blue 93's etc... i can go on

If they make a ton of them, they sit people don't want something that everyone else has. See TB3's. See MS4's. Hell look at the Pinnacles. They blow any of the AMD pairs out of the water from a quality standpoint and they are still sitting a lot of places. It's a double edge sword and the only way Nike wins is if they make limited batches. People want limited stuff but they'll cry when they aren't able to get it. That's better for Nike than people turning their nose up at it bc it's not limited.
